Output dd24c95112b38c037ffda77ed6b12cba32a91d192f66f89b092c2059ea6b5268:1

value
752155
script pubkey
OP_0 OP_PUSHBYTES_20 648b738aea98d87b5b4a2c31502ec605b540b967
address
ltc1qvj9h8zh2nrv8kk629sc4qtkxqk65pwt80a9yjm
transaction
dd24c95112b38c037ffda77ed6b12cba32a91d192f66f89b092c2059ea6b5268
spent
true